Because the game's localization took a very long while. Even though it was originally released in Japan on December 2012 along with its Link! extension on July 2013, the absence of any form of definitive confirmation of a localized version from Level 5 made people worrying that the game might not come in overseas territories. That is, until E3 2014 opened its doors and proven us wrong.

DLC announced:

A downloadable content pack called Origin Island ? available for purchase from the Nintendo eShop at launch ? will extend the Fantasy Life adventure even further. Origin Island offers a new area that is home to an ancient culture and powerful enemies, additional story content, new ranks to achieve in Life Classes, access to even more powerful equipment and two new varieties of pets to adopt: birds and dragons.
